The name Oyester is derived from the English word 'oyster,' symbolizing something rare and valuable, much like the precious pearls oysters create. Historically, oysters have represented hidden treasures and the idea of beauty emerging from humble origins. Oyester as a given name embodies uniqueness, rarity, and hidden potential, often linked metaphorically to personal growth and discovery.

Cultural Significance of Oyester

While Oyester as a personal name is rare and modern, oysters themselves have held cultural significance across history and civilizations. Symbolizing wealth, fertility, and hidden beauty, oysters appear in ancient myths and art. Naming a child Oyester can invoke these qualities, aligning the bearer with themes of mystery, value, and natural wonder, bridging nature and human identity in a poetic way.
